London Borough of Redbridge Council | Remote Working

London Borough of Redbridge is the local authority for Redbridge in Greater London, England, and one of the capital’s 32 borough councils. They employ over 1600 people and aspire to place Redbridge at the cutting edge of local government in the 21st century.

 

Here’s how we supported London Borough of Redbridge Council with replacing their Direct Access environment.

 

The problem

As a direct result of Covid-19, the Council urgently needed to strengthen their existing remote access infrastructure, improve reliability, make it more robust and ultimately improve user experience with faster secure access to resources.

 

Given the business-critical nature of this engagement, PowerON provided introductory calls, scoped the business and technical requirements, established commercial and partnership agreements and had a consultant onsite within 8 days of our first call with their team.

 

The solution

We worked with London Borough of Redbridge Council to set up a flexible support contract that enabled instant support from our expert team of consultants. Time was spent reviewing the current IT estate, and isolating the factors that were restricting reliability and performance for the higher number of remote workers during these unprecedent circumstances. Due to the urgent nature of this new remote working demand, over a Bank Holiday weekend, the PowerON and Council’s teams worked together to successfully deploy a new robust Direct Access solution.

 

As a result of the rapid response from London Borough of Redbridge Council, they were able to significantly and securely improve the remote access solution, which not only increased productivity, but empowered all council employees to continue to support their community from home with little impact to their day to day activities, while not compromising the council information security posture.
